Contractors making deliveries to the Pelworth Annexe loading dock should note that goods are accepted only between 07:00 and 11:30 on weekdays, and all arrivals must be logged with the dock steward before unloading begins. Vehicles left on the ramp outside these hours will be turned away. To open the dock shutter, enter the access code below.

badge for fafop-fajof: bdg-Z-47

## SpokeShift — Env Vars

Reviewer notes: REBALANCE_INTERVAL_MIN (default 15) and MAX_TRUCK_LOAD (default 20) are validated at startup; reject PRs that bypass the bounds check. All vars live in .env, loaded once. The dock-telemetry API won't return station counts without an auth credential, so the service needs this line added to .env.

sealed setting: RELAY_SECRET5=82864

### Checklist Item 7: SDK Feature Parity

Before tagging the Lantern Messaging release, confirm the Quillfox and Marrowtide client SDKs expose identical surface areas for the v4 subscription APIs. Run the parity audit script against both generated manifests and attach the diff to the release folder. Any method present in one SDK but missing in the other blocks the cut — no exceptions this cycle, per the Brindlemoor review. Once the audit passes clean, record the verified build token on the line that follows.

session token of hawif-bajog = htk6_9ab8da